What is Realty Portfolio Diversity?
Realty portfolio diversification entails buying a mix of residential or commercial properties to decrease reliance on a solitary asset kind or place. Rather than focusing all investments in one property kind, such as domestic or commercial, diversity enables you to leverage chances throughout various industries and areas.

Benefits of Realty Profile Diversification
1. Danger Reduction
A diversified profile reduces the influence of market recessions. As an example, if the property market encounters a stagnation, gains in commercial or commercial properties can offset possible losses.

2. Stable Capital
Purchasing different residential property types supplies numerous revenue streams. Lasting rentals use constant cash flow, while short-term services or trip properties produce higher seasonal earnings.

3. Accessibility to Development Markets
Branching out geographically permits capitalists to tap into high-growth regions. Arising markets frequently use far better returns compared to well established ones.

4. Property Defense
Spreading investments throughout residential or commercial property types and areas aids secure your profile from local events like natural disasters, economic recessions, or policy changes.

5. Boosted Returns
Diversity uses direct exposure to residential properties with differing appreciation rates, boosting general returns in time.

Ways to Diversify Your Property Profile
1. Discover Various Property Types
Purchase a mix of residential, business, commercial, and retail homes.

Residential Properties: Single-family homes, multi-family devices, or apartment building.
Commercial Residences: Office buildings, retail rooms, or mixed-use growths.
Industrial Residence: Storehouses, logistics centers, or manufacturing facilities.
2. Branch out Geographically
Expand your financial investments to different cities, states, or even countries. For example:

Urban facilities for high rental need.
Suburbs for family-oriented residential properties.
Vacationer locations for trip services.
3. Take Advantage Of Different Financial Investment Techniques
Make use of different strategies, such as:

Purchase and Hold: For lasting appreciation.
Flipping: For fast earnings through residential or commercial property remodellings.
REITs ( Realty Financial Investment Trusts): For hands-off investment in varied property portfolios.
4. Purchase Emerging Markets
Research and purchase markets with solid economic development, enhancing population, or advancement tasks.

5. Add Property Crowdfunding to Your Portfolio
Crowdfunding systems use accessibility to a series of residential or commercial property financial investments, consisting of business and domestic projects, with lower resources demands.

Examples of Real Estate Profile Diversity
Case Study 1: Residential and Commercial Balance
An investor allocates 60% of their funds to homes in suburbs and 40% to commercial homes in urban centers. This technique supplies stable rental revenue and exposure to higher-yielding commercial areas.

Study 2: Geographical Diversification
An investor spreads their portfolio across 3 areas:

A single-family home in New york city.
A holiday leasing in Florida.
A business storage facility in Texas.
This geographic variety reduces dangers related to local financial declines.

Case Study 3: REITs and Straight Ownership
An capitalist combines direct residential or commercial property ownership with REIT investments, gaining direct exposure to large-scale business growths without the headache of straight administration.
